I've created 8 questions so far that might prove useful later in my research:

1. What other career fields come into play when editing a film?
2. What are some ways to keep organized while editing?
3. What challenges have you faced while editing and how did you manage to overcome them?
4. In what ways does the editor have an impact on the final product in terms of emotion and message?
5. How can a video be cut down, yet retain its original focus?
6. What needs to be done before the video gets into the editor’s hands?
7. How long does it usually take to edit a TV show?
8. How much footage should be captured to ensure that the editor has enough to work with?
